Chapter 4. Deprecated functionality
This section provides an overview of functionality that has been deprecated in all minor releases up to this release of Red Hat Ceph Storage.
Deprecated functionality continues to be supported until the end of life of Red Hat Ceph Storage 9. Deprecated functionality will likely not be supported in future major releases of this product and is not recommended for new deployments. For the most recent list of deprecated functionality within a particular major release, refer to the latest version of release documentation.
Deprecated method of configuring OIDC federation and IAM roles at the tenant level
All OIDC resources are now managed as resources within a Ceph Object Gateway account. These OIDC resources include providers, roles, and polices, As a result, all OIDC operations that target a tenant, including the global or empty tenant, are considered deprecated. The deprecated operations incldue creating providers, creating roles, and assuming roles.
With the newer per-account model, federated users are directly associated with the account and Ceph Object Gateway no longer creates shadow users (for example, TENANT$USER_NAMESPACE) upon role assumption. The account itself tracks all resources and identities.
Tenant-based OIDC federation users should migrate their configurations to the new Ceph Object Gateway per-account model, before feature removal.
